Spinning
Spinning
Twirling all around
Free, not bound to the ground
So dizzy I'm not able to see strait
Nauseas and I think I might faint
So fun I'm not able to stop
Even though my ears are starting to pop
Cannot walk the right way
Trip and fall, I think I may
Even though spinning makes me feel weird and funny
It doesn't matter because outside its warm and sunny
